In this course, students further explore themes relating to Greek or Cypriot culture and society as illustrated in a selection of authentic written, aural and/or visual texts. Students may be offered a choice of monographic studies relating to contemporary or earlier texts. Regular offerings include Asia Minor: from antiquity through to modern times, Cyprus: history and tradition, From the Point of View of Alexandria, Greek Mythology: Gods, Heroes and Mortals, Modern Greek literature, Greek Migration to Australia.
